ROCKY ROAD BARS

Provided by Food Network

Categories     dessert

Time 25m

Yield 36 to 48 bars

Number Of Ingredients 22



Rocky Road Bars image

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ees. Lightly grease and flour a 9x13-inch pan.
  • To make the first layer: Place the butter and chocolate in a small pan and cook over the lowest possible heat until almost all the chocolate has melted. Off heat, add the sugar, eggs, vanilla, flour, nuts, and baking powder and mix well. Press into the prepared pan and set aside.
  • To make the second layer: Place the cream cheese, sugar, flour, butter, egg, and vanilla in the bowl of a mixer fitter with a paddle and mix until smooth and fluffy. Scrape down the sides of the bowl, add the nuts, mix to combine, and spread over the first layer. Sprinkle with the chocolate chips and transfer to the oven. Bake until slightly golden on the edges, about 20 to 25 minutes.
  • Sprinkle the second layer with the marshmallows and return the pan to the oven until the marshmallows are just melted but not colored, about 3 minutes.
  • To make the frosting: Place the butter and chocolate in a small pan and cook over the lowest possible heat until almost all the chocolate has melted. Add the cream cheese and milk and mix until smooth. Add the confectioners' sugar and vanilla and mix until smooth. Immediately pour the frosting over the marshmallows and briefly swirl the two mixtures together. Cool in the pan and cut into 36 to 48 bars. Cover and refrigerate.

1/4 pound (1 stick) unsalted butter
1 ounce unsweetened chocolate
1 cup sugar
2 eggs, at room temperature
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 to 1 cup coarsely chopped toasted walnuts, pecans, or peanuts
1 teaspoon baking powder
6 ounces cream cheese, at room temperature
1/2 cup sugar
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1/4 cup (4 tablespoons)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1 egg, at room temperature
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/4 cup toated walnuts, pecans, or peanuts, coarsely chopped
1 cup semisweet chocolate chips
1/4 cup (4 tablespoons) unsalted butter
1 ounce unsweetened chocolate
2 ounces cream cheese
1/4 cup whole milk
1 cup confectioners' s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

NO-BAKE ROCKY ROAD BARS

Provided by Trisha Yearwood

Categories     dessert

Time 1h15m

Yield about 16 bars

Number Of Ingredients 12



No-Bake Rocky Road Bars image

Steps:

  • For the bars: Line a 9-by-13-inch baking pan with parchment so that the edges fold over the sides of the pan. Spray with cooking spray.
  • Add the sweetened condensed milk, cream cheese and butter to a medium pot and place over low heat. Cook, whisking occasionally so the bottom does not brown, until melted and well combined, a few minutes.
  • Put the pecans, walnuts, graham crackers and marshmallows in a bowl; set aside.
  • When the cream cheese mixture has melted, whisk until well combined, and then remove from the heat. Fold in the chocolate chips and mix until all the chocolate is melted and the mixture is well combined.
  • Pour the chocolate mixture into the bowl with the graham cracker mixture. Pour the mixture into the prepared pan and place in the fridge for 1 to 1 1/2 hours to set.
  • For the quick marshmallow frosting: In the bowl of st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at the sugar and butter until creamy, a couple of minutes. Beat in the marshmallow creme.
  • Remove the set mixture from the pan. Cut into squares and frost with or dip in the marshmallow frosting. Keep refrigerated.

Cooking spray
One 14-ounce can sweetened condensed milk
8 ounces cream cheese
3 tablespoons salted butter
1 cup toasted, chopped pecans
1 cup toasted, chopped walnuts
8 full graham crackers (1 sleeve), broken into chunks
One 10-ounce bag mini marshmallows
3 cups semisweet chocolate chips
2 cups confectioners' sugar
1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, softened
One 16-ounce jar marshmallow creme, such as Marshmallow Fluff

ROCKY ROAD CRUNCH BARS

No one is ever going to complain about having one of these in their lunchbox, and they're pretty handy to have around in a kitchen for a quick, snatched burst of energy at any time. I'm not claiming them to be a health food, but when you're talking about lunch on the run, packing quite a few calories into a small parcel can be viewed as a positive advantage. That's my view, and I'm sticking to it.

Provided by Nigella Lawson : Food Network

Categories     dessert

Time 2h15m

Yield 24 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6



Rocky Road Crunch Bars image

Steps:

  • Melt the butter, chocolate and syrup in a heavy based saucepan. Scoop out about 1/2 cup of this melted mixture and put aside.
  • Put the biscuits/cookies into a freezer bag and then bash them with a rolling pin. You are looking for both crumbs and pieces of cookies.
  • Fold the cookie pieces and crumbs into the melted chocolate mixture, and then add the marshmallows.
  • Pour into a 9-inch square foil tray; flatten as best you can with a spatula. Pour over the reserved 1/2 half cup of melted chocolate mixture and smooth the top.
  • Refrigerate for about 2 hours or overnight.
  • Cut into 24 fingers and dust with powdered sugar by pushing it gently through a tea strainer or small sieve.

1 stick plus 1 tablespoon soft unsalted butter
10 ounces semisweet chocolate, broken into pieces
3 tablespoons golden syrup or 1/4 cup corn syrup
8 ounces plain hard and crunchy cookies
2 cups mini marshmallows
2 teaspoons powdered sugar

ROCKY ROAD CANDIES

It couldn't be easier to make this treat. Just melt chocolate chips and stir in peanuts and marshmallows.

Provided by sal

Categories     Desserts     Candy Recipes     Chocolate Candy Recipes

Time 2h10m

Yield 24

Number Of Ingredients 5



Rocky Road Candies image

Steps:

  • Line a 9 x 13 inch pan with wax paper.
  • In a microwave-safe bowl, microwave chocolate and butter until melted. Stir occasionally until chocolate is smooth. Stir in condensed milk. Combine peanuts and marshmallows; stir into chocolate mixture. Pour into prepared pan and chill until firm. Cut into squares.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 283.6 calories, Carbohydrate 36.3 g, Cholesterol 8.1 mg, Fat 14.1 g, Fiber 2 g, Protein 5.5 g, SaturatedFat 5 g, Sodium 53.3 mg, Sugar 27.8 g

1 (12 ounce) package semisweet chocolate chips
⅛ cup butter
1 (14 ounce) can sweetened condensed milk
2 ½ cups dry-roasted peanuts
1 (16 ounce) package miniature marshmallows

ROCKY ROAD BARS

These yummy chocolate bars are called rocky road because the chocolate chips, nuts and marshmallows make them lumpy and bumpy, just like a "rocky" road.

Provided by By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Dessert

Time 45m

Yield 30

Number Of Ingredients 8



Rocky Road Bars image

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350°. Grease bottom only of rectangular pan, 13x9x2 inches. Heat 1/2 cup of the chocolate chips and the butter in heavy 1-quart saucepan over low heat, stirring occasionally, until melted.
  • Mix baking mix, sugar, vanilla, eggs and chocolate mixture; spread in pan. Bake 15 minutes.
  • Sprinkle with marshmallows, nuts and remaining 1/2 cup chocolate chips. Bake 10 to 15 minutes or until marshmallows are light brown. Cool completely. Cut into about 2-inch squares.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 115, Carbohydrate 17 g, Cholesterol 15 mg, Fat 1, Fiber 0 g, Protein 1 g, SaturatedFat 2 g, ServingSize 1 Bar, Sodium 130 mg

1 cup semisweet chocolate chips
2 tablespoon butter or margarine
2 cups Bisquick™ Original baking mix
1 cup sugar
1/2 teaspoon vanilla
2 eggs
1 cup miniature marshmallows
1/4 cup chopped nuts, if desired
